Assisted living is long-term care for seniors who are generally active and independent, but who require increased supervision and help with some daily tasks. Staff can assist residents with activities of daily living like dressing, bathing, and medication management. Assisted living is also a good option for seniors seeking more socialization. In Iowa, the annual median cost for an assisted living community is around $48,933 . Iowa maintains specific rules associated with this type of community. The Department of Inspections and Appeals, Health communities Division governs this community type. This community has a number of provisions concerning food and diet which include a healthcare provider must review food preparation and service procedures, a licensed dietitian must be available to write and approve the therapeutic menu, communities must provide hot meals at least once a day, and a health care provider must prescribe a therapeutic diet. This type of community is required to offer a number of services. These include health-related services, resident access to a 24-hour personal emergency response system, assistance with activities of daily living, and assistance with personal care. This type of community is required to have a staff member on duty 24 hours a day. The minimum number of residents for this community type is 3. There must be one bath or shower for every 1 residents and one toilet for every 1 residents. Staff must receive training in a number of areas. These include: accident, assisted living management or nursing course, fire safety, and emergency procedures. This community type has a number of provisions pertaining to medication assistance. These provisions include self-administer medications, reading instructions or other label information, and opening containers. Before a resident is accepted, they must go through a service plan screening to make sure their needs are going to be met. This screening includes a number of areas of interest such as negotiated risk agreement, a multidisciplinary team must be involved in service planning when residents require personal care or health-related services, and a comprehensive mental and physical assessment. Public assistance is available through Medicaid 1915(c) Elderly Waiver program.
The current population of Jefferson consists of 3,731 people and in total the Jefferson metro area has a population of 4,150. Jefferson has a population density of 268 people per square mile. In Jefferson, 10.7% of the people are veterans. Of the population of Jefferson 6.9% have a graduate degree, 23.3% have a college degree, and 32.6% have a high-school diploma. Out of the total city population, 45.9% are male and 54.1% are female. The median age of Jefferson is 48 years old. In Jefferson, 7.0% do not have health insurance, 8.8% live in poverty, 62.8% participate in the labor force, and 14.2% have some form of disability. Racially, the population of Jefferson is 0.2% Native American, 0.1% Pacific Islander or Native Hawaiian, 1.1% mixed race, 3.3% Hispanic, 2.3% Asian, 0.2% black, 0.0% other or not specified, and 96.2% white.
The total cost of living can be a big influence in deciding which location works for your family. The median home value in Jefferson is about $91,979 and the median rent is $692 a month. The rent burden for Jefferson is around 12.4% of the average person’s monthly income.
In terms of resources, Iowa has a cost of living index of 91.8, a grocery index rating of 95.9, and a housing index rating of 79.6. These index ratings are based on a system where 100 is considered the national average and anything below 100 is considered less expensive than the national average.
